How to Make Butterfly Embellishments
Small, sparkling butterflies add a touch of whimsy, magic and elegance to anything they grace, from clothing and fashion accessories to party tables, home decorations, wedding accents and everything in between. Give a standard, simple object a magical, whimsical touch by making and adding your own homemade butterfly embellishments to plain-looking gifts or other items. Use simple materials such as paper and clay to form small, charming butterfly embellishments to attach to a variety of objects in playful or stylish ways.
Things You'll Need
- Paper
- Scissors
- Construction paper, decorative paper or card stock
- Air dry modeling clay
- Butterfly cookie cutter
- Clear spray sealer
- Glitter or shimmer powder
- Craft or super glue
Instructions
-
Paper Butterflies
-
1
Purchase a wooden butterfly shape template from a craft store or use a stencil to make one yourself. Draw the shape onto a plain piece of paper and cut it out.
-
2
Use the template to trace the butterfly shape onto a piece of construction paper, decorative paper or card stock.
-
-
3
Cut the butterfly shape out from the decorative paper.
-
4
Fold the butterfly in half and make a small, “V” shaped notch in the center of the fold. Embellish wine glasses, thin photo frames, mirrors or other objects with a thin edge by pushing the butterfly notch onto the edge of glass, plastic or wood to hold it in place.
-
5
Gently spread wings apart to give the appearance that the butterfly has just landed on the item you have adorned with this embellishment.
Clay Butterflies
-
6
Roll a small ball of clay between your hands and press it down like a pancake onto a flat surface. Use more or less clay depending on the desired size and thickness of the butterfly embellishment.
-
7
Position a butterfly cookie cutter over the clay cake and firmly press it into the clay, removing excess clay from the edges before lifting the cutter away.
-
8
Allow the clay butterfly to dry completely according to clay instructions.
-
9
Spray your hardened clay butterfly with a coat of clear spray sealer, sprinkle or dust on a little glitter or shimmer powder, and dry completely according to sealer instructions.
-
10
Use super glue or craft glue to affix clay butterfly embellishments to photo frames and albums, jewelry boxes, bookshelves, gifts, coffee mugs or other items.

Tips & Warnings
Decorate butterfly embellishments with glitter glue pens, puffy paint, markers, colored pencils, small rhinestones or other craft items for an elegant, playful or stylish effect.
Glue a magnet to the back of butterflies to embellish magnetic surfaces such as refrigerators, metal filing cabinets and magnetic dry erase boards.
Use a small clay sculpting tool or a toothpick to etch detail lines onto clay butterfly wings before drying.
Push an ornament hook through clay butterflies before drying to make hanging butterfly ornaments for embellishing Christmas trees, windows, rearview mirrors, dresser drawers or other objects and places where a small butterfly can hang.
Use spray sealer in a well-ventilated area.
